Jesus Christ is the stone that the builders rejected, who, by not being jealous of His prerogative as the Son of God, but humbly sacrificing Himself on Calvary’s Cross rather than saying “Mine”, has become the chief cornerstone of the worship of God. Through the humility of Jesus Christ, the jealousy of the Jewish religious leadership has been exposed and finally rejected. Through the humility of Jesus Christ, the works of the devil are finally defeated, and the power of God is made manifest in the earth.
